Summary: Excellent Resource for Educators and Social Service Workers
Comment: Containing a collection of essays and practical suggestions for applying ideas from folklore to everyday life, this book is an important contribution to those engaged in education as well as the delivery of social services. There are great ideas about using the everyday culture of various communities for intervention work in a variety of employment settings. Teachers will find useful ideas and a well-written bibliography on the use of folklore in the classroom. Park and recreation workers will find a good resource for developing projects and programs that use locally-based cultural resources for their programming. The book contains ample ideas that can be used by those in medical fields, prisons, libraries, refugee services, and other organizations that work to deliver services to the public. The book also contains a good introduction to the history and practice of studying folklore, and the excellent bibliographic references will provide readers with a variety of resources for further developing the approaches offered in this volume.
